Tftp-hpa in lucid was shipped with a bug that when the log files are rotated nothing is written in the log files after the restart. This has been fixed in natty with a recent merge of tftp-hpa. I have backported the back to lucid and have attached the debdiff to this bug.
To reproduce:
1. Install tftpd-hpa
2. Check to see if log files for tftpd-hpa is running.
3. Rotate the /etc/cron.daily/logrotate
4. Check to see if tftpd-hpa is writting to the log files.
